What is Income-based Medicine?


1.

n. A style of treating patients implicitly based on their socialand financial status (be it by quality or lack of insurance, etc.).

ant. outcome-based medicine, of which this term is a parody.

When I was in the ER, I didn't have proof of insurance on me, so they asked me to make a deposit of $100... as if it were income-based medicine or something!
